Google’s Quantum Leap: New Digital Signatures to Keep Hackers Quaking!
Google Cloud has introduced quantum-safe digital signatures in its Cloud Key Management Service to counter quantum computing threats. These signatures support two post-quantum cryptography algorithms, aligning with NIST standards. The proactive move anticipates future risks, ensuring encryption stays a step ahead of quantum capabilities.

Key Points:
- Google Cloud has introduced quantum-safe digital signatures in its Cloud Key Management Service (Cloud KMS).
- This move is to counter the threat of quantum computing on current encryption systems.
- New features support quantum-proof signatures using two specific post-quantum cryptography algorithms.
- The initiative aligns with NIST’s PQC standards, which were formalized in August 2024.
- Google’s roadmap includes open-source software implementations and potential hybridization scheme support.
